100 ошибок Go и как их избежать
Эта книга представляет собой уникальное практическое руководство, посвящённое анализу 100 типичных ошибок и неэффективных приёмов, встречающихся в Go-приложениях. Автор, Тейва Харшани, систематизировал распространённые проблемы, с которыми сталкиваются разработчики, и предлагает чёткие методики их предотвращения.
Книга охватывает широкий спектр тем — от основополагающих аспектов языка, таких как типы данных, управляющие структуры и работа со строками, до более сложных областей: конкурентное программирование, обработка ошибок, тестирование и оптимизация кода. Каждая ошибка рассматривается на конкретных примерах, что позволяет не только понять её суть, но и научиться писать идиоматичный, выразительный и надёжный код.
Материал структурирован по категориям, что облегчает навигацию и изучение. Отдельные главы посвящены организации кода и проекта, функциям и методам, а также возможностям стандартной библиотеки. Книга поможет опытным Go-разработчикам выйти на новый уровень мастерства, избегая распространённых подводных камней и антипаттернов.
Издание входит в серию «Для профессионалов» и ориентировано на разработчиков, уже знакомых с синтаксисом Go, но стремящихся углубить свои знания и улучшить качество создаваемого программного обеспечения.









